Etounup Ainu Folk Craft Rare, Excellent Condition Sake Pourer Length: Approximately 215 mm Width: Approximately 145 mm The Etounup is used by the Ainu people when they gather in large numbers for a drinking party. It is used to transfer sake from the barrel before pouring it into cups. Similar to the Nima, the wood is carved using various blades, and then the outside is shaved to shape it. Because it was used in a considerably old era, the existing items are thought to have been made for the sake of traditional culture.
